Rose Winkler Obituary

Winkler, Rose Mary (nee Sniegolski), beloved wife of the late Francis Albert "Scotty", loving mother of Mary Illana (Stan) Perrin, Albert (Donna), Claudia (Mike) Kisielente, Patrick (Carol) and Dennis (Caroline), loving grandmother of Heather, Scott, Dylan, Gwendolyn, Anna, Neil, Jocelyn, Ellen, Sean, Nolan and Clark, great-grandmother of Jaxsun and Alina, sister of Ray, Betty, the late Irene, the late Verna, the late Tony and the late May, aunt of many nieces and nephews. Funeral Wednesday, March 10, 2010, 9:45 a.m. at Szykowny Funeral Home, Jonathan F. Siedlecki, Director, 4901 S. Archer (1 blk east of Pulaski at Szykowny Blvd.) to St. Mary Star of the Sea. Mass 10:30 a.m. Interment St. Mary Cemetery. Visitation Tuesday, 3 p.m. to 9 p.m. Info 773-735-7521.
